Project Update
The junction between Simblist and Bumborah Point Roads at Port Botany was a busy place last weekend as Ward successfully completed the critical intersection pavement replacement works over a 46 hour continuous shift.
The works involved removal of the failed pavement, subgrade preparation and construction of the new pavement utilising high early strength concrete.
Work was carried out over the weekend to minimise the impact on NSW Ports tenants who rely on this intersection on a daily basis.
